The motors and gearing of different robotics
Industrial six-axis robotics often integrate frameless motors at their axes. Over the last decade, permanent-magnet brushless servomotors have come to dominate. Increasingly common in six-axis robotic assemblies are frameless and direct-drive variations. A high motor pole count (with strain-wave gearing) yields high torque output and low cogging. PI releases F-713 6-axis photonics aligner with new controller
PI (Physik Instrumente) has released the F-713, an updated version of its F-712 6-axis alignment system for photonics chips, fiber arrays and wafers. The F-713 retains the F-712 hybrid mechanical design based on a hexapod and piezo-scanner combination and adds a controller with increased capability and flexibility to support future photonics alignment requirements. PI introduces A-688 air-bearing rotary stage for precision motion
PI, a provider of precision motion control and air bearing motion systems, has introduced the A-688 rotary stage, a motorized, air-bearing rotation stage designed for high-precision, frictionless motion and long-term reliability in metrology, optics, photonics and semiconductor applications.
